Frequently Asked Questions About battery powered small grow light ceiling

How do I choose the right battery powered small grow light ceiling for my plants and space?

The key is to balance power, portability, and fit: pick a ceiling-mountable, battery-powered LED light with sufficient brightness, the right spectrum for growth, and a battery life that matches your daily light cycle. Start by considering the size of your grow area, the plants you’re growing, and whether you need dimming or remote control. Look for models with rechargeable batteries (often around 4000mAh in these options) and reliable COB LED technology from brands like generic or dp. Finally, check mounting compatibility and safety ratings to ensure secure, spill-free operation.

What is the most complex attribute to evaluate in these lights, and how should I judge it?

Battery capacity and runtime are the most complex attributes because they determine how long your plants stay lit between charges. A higher mAh rating generally means longer operation, but efficiency depends on LED quality, brightness setting, and beam angle. For COB-based ceiling models, expect around a 4000mAh pack in many options, and choose a light with adjustable brightness or dimming to conserve power. Also consider charging method and whether the unit has a remote control for easy tweaks from anywhere.

What maintenance and compatibility steps should I follow to keep these battery powered lights safe and effective?

Ensure you mount the fixture securely to suit your ceiling type and avoid moisture-prone areas. Regularly clean the lens with a dry or slightly damp cloth and check for battery connectivity and remote function. Use within indoor dry environments and follow charging guidelines for the built‑in pack, and avoid overfilling or exposing the battery to heat. If you’re using a hanging LED option, verify weight limits and wall or ceiling anchors are appropriate for long-term use.

Are there practical tips to maximize growth while staying within a ceiling-mounted, battery-powered setup?

Yes—maximize results by placing the light at an appropriate distance to avoid scorching while delivering even coverage, using the lowest effective brightness for seedlings, and scheduling a consistent light cycle. Choose a model with a broad beam angle to cover the intended area and use the remote to adjust brightness as plants grow. Remember to rotate pots periodically for uniform exposure and keep the battery charged according to the manufacturer’s guidance.
